Free School Meals, Healthy Snacks And Fresh Fruit For Primary School Pupils In Hull
EDM number 753 in 2003-04, proposed by Kevin McNamara on 02/03/2004.
That this House supports the innovative proposals by the Labour Group at Hull City Council to provide free school meals, healthy snacks and fresh fruit to all primary school pupils and expand the number of breakfast clubs throughout Kingston upon Hull; notes with concern that a child in Kingston upon Hull is, on average, going to live six years fewer than a child in Kingston upon Thames and that a recent survey ranked Kingston upon Hull as the worst local authority area for obesity whilst Kingston upon Thames is the best; welcomes the fact that this scheme will ensure that all primary pupils are able to receive healthy food during the school day as well as promoting healthy eating; further notes that this measure will help improve school attainment and attendance, reduce health inequalities and increase the life changes of children in Kingston upon Hull; welcomes the widespread support for this measure; and urges all political parties at Hull City Council to endorse the introduction of this measure.
This motion has been signed by a total of 30 MPs.
